HEALTH TECHNICIAN

Purpose Statement

The job of Health Technician was established for the purpose/s of performing student health duties at assigned school site under the direction of a school nurse; administering first aid and supervising students self administering prescribed medications in accordance with policies and practices, assisting in student vision and hearing screening testing; assisting with student care; and maintaining confidential student health records.

This job reports to Administrator/Supervisor

Essential Functions
  • Administers, in the absence of the nurse, emergency first aid (e.g. CPR, AED, asthma and/or low blood sugar episodes, injuries including head/neck, fractures, etc.) for the purpose of meeting immediate health care needs.
  • Attends in-service trainings, staff meetings, workshops, etc. as requested for the purpose of conveying and/or gathering information required to perform job functions.
  • Communicates with the school nurse, site administrators, and students (e.g. observations, messages, status) for the purpose of ensuring the safety and well being of the students.
  • Consults with Nurse/Administrators regarding a variety of issues (e.g. emergency situations, neglect/abuse, assessment needs, infectious/contagious diseases,) for the purpose of resolving immediate safety and/or health care concerns, minimizing infection and complying with the law.
  • Coordinates a variety of onsite screenings and clinics (e.g. vision, hearing, Wellness, Dental, etc.) for the purpose of ensuring timely completion of event and complying with established regulations.
  • Maintains a variety of manual and electronic records and files most of which are confidential (e.g. medical emergency cards, medical alert status, Epipen; allergy; medication logs, accident reports, daily illness/injury logs, supply inventories, mandated screening, immunization records, Health Concern List, etc.) for the purpose of maintaining accuracy in records and/or providing information required for health mandates for ISBE and or Health Department.
  • Maintains educational and instructional materials on a variety of health subjects for the purpose of ensuring items are available for distribution to teachers, students and/or parents.
  • Maintains work areas (e.g. sinks, counters, beds, blankets, etc.) for the purpose of maintaining area in accordance with established standards.
  • Monitors students self-administering medications (under the direction of a health care professional) for the purpose of meeting the ongoing health care needs of students.
  • Performs a variety of screenings (by assignment) (e.g. scoliosis, color blindness, vision, hearing, lice checks, height/weight, etc.) for the purpose of complying with federal and state regulations.
  • Prepares a wide variety of written materials (e.g. logs, re-screen lists, student records, accident reports, notices, periodic and year-end reports, letters to parents about food allergies, etc..) for the purpose of ensuring compliance with established regulations, documenting activities, providing written reference and/or conveying information.
  • Processes student's new and withdrawal forms for the purpose of ensuring completeness of records, conveying information, and complying with district, state and federal requirements.
  • Responds to inquiries from a variety of internal and external parties by phone, letter or in person (e.g. staff, parents, students, public agencies, etc.) for the purpose of providing information, facilitating communication and/or direction/referral as may be required.
  • Supervises students within the health room for the purpose of monitoring students referred for illness and/or observation.

Job Requirements: Minimum Qualifications

Skills, Knowledge and Abilities

SKILLS are required to perform multiple tasks with a potential need to upgrade skills in order to meet changing job conditions. Specific skill-based competencies required to satisfactorily perform the functions of the job include: administering first aid/CPR; performing vision, hearing, screening tests; handling body fluids and waste materials; operating standard office equipment including pertinent software applications; and preparing and maintaining accurate records.

KNOWLEDGE is required to perform basic math, including calculations using fractions, percents, and/or ratios; read technical information, compose a variety of documents, and/or facilitate group discussions; and solve practical problems. Specific knowledge-based competencies required to satisfactorily perform the functions of the job include: emergency first aid/CPR procedures; universal precautions and infection control procedures; health standards and reporting procedures.

ABILITY is required to schedule a number of activities, meetings, and/or events; gather, collate, and/or classify data; and use basic, job-related equipment. Flexibility is required to work with others in a wide variety of circumstances; work with data utilizing defined but different processes; and operate equipment using defined methods. Ability is also required to work with a diversity of individuals and/or groups; work with data of varied types and/or purposes; and utilize job-related equipment. Problem solving is required to identify issues and create action plans. Problem solving with data requires independent interpretation of guidelines; and problem solving with equipment is limited to moderate. Specific ability-based competencies required to satisfactorily perform the functions of the job include: maintaining confidentiality; adapting to changing work priorities; being attentive to detail; displaying tact and courtesy; communicating with diverse groups of individuals; meeting deadlines and schedules; working with constant interruptions; and ability to read, write and communicate clearly in English.

Responsibility

Responsibilities include: working under limited supervision following standardized practices and/or methods; leading, guiding, and/or coordinating others; and operating within a defined budget. Utilization of some resources from other work units is often required to perform the job's functions. There is a continual opportunity to impact the organization's services.

Working Environment

The usual and customary methods of performing the job's functions require the following physical demands: occasional lifting, carrying, pushing, and/or pulling; frequent stooping, kneeling, crouching, and/or crawling; and significant fine finger dexterity. Generally the job requires 20% sitting, 40% walking, and 40% standing. The job is performed under conditions with exposure to risk of injury and/or illness and in a clean atmosphere.
